10 Best Stocks for 2012

The InvestorPlace 10 Best Stocks for 2012 includes 10 long-term investments from a group of money managers, market experts and financial journalists. Returns will be based on market close Friday, Dec. 30. Throughout the year, the writers will regularly offer updates on the good, the bad and the unexpected as it relates to their best stock for 2012.
